Bobby talks to Garang Kuol's former coach at Golbourn Valley Suns FC, Craig Carley, about the Newcastle new boy. Craig thinks that Kuol has the potential to become one of the best players in the world. He shares some insights on Garang's life in Shepparton, his family background, and the personality of the young man who has been catapulted into the limelight over the last few months. When and how did Craig first spot Kuol's talent, and how does he think he will cope with the rapid rise from semi-professional NPL, to the A League, to the Premier League? Craig also shares some stories from the GV Suns days. Fascinating insights and information from a man who knows Kuol almost as well as anybody in football.

This week brought confirmation that the newest Socceroo and teen sensation Garang Kuol will join Newcastle in January. It's a transfer that has caught the imagination Down Under, and has induced a wave of emotion in the Toon Under Pod crew, as this sparkling talent from Shepparton, Victoria with a refugee background signs for the richest club in the world. Keegan and Dimi chat about who Garang Kuol is, where he came from, what his strengths and weaknesses are, which established players he is similar to and how he took the A League by storm this year. The lads also cover Garangski's possible development path over the next few years, and assess the immediate chances of him making an impact at the World Cup in Qatar.
